Elevate Your Professional Wardrobe: Trends in Scrubs for Women

In the fast-paced world of healthcare, the attire worn by medical professionals plays a significant role not just in comfort and functionality but also in style and professionalism. Scrubs, once considered purely functional, have evolved into a statement of personal expression and identity within the medical community. For women in healthcare, choosing the right scrubs can enhance both confidence and comfort during long shifts. This guest post explores the latest trends and considerations when selecting scrubs for women, ensuring that every healthcare professional can find a perfect balance of fashion and function.

1. Embracing Fashion and Functionality: Today, scrubs for women are designed with both style and functionality in mind. From innovative fabrics that offer comfort and durability to modern cuts that flatter different body types, healthcare apparel brands are catering to the diverse needs of women in the medical field. Gone are the days of one-size-fits-all; now, scrubs come in a variety of styles, colors, and patterns that allow women to express their personal style while maintaining a polished and professional appearance.

2. Trending Styles and Designs:

  • Tailored Fits: Scrubs with tailored fits are increasingly popular among women, providing a more flattering silhouette without sacrificing comfort or mobility.
  • Athleisure Influence: Athleisure-inspired scrubs are gaining traction, featuring stretchy fabrics, moisture-wicking properties, and stylish details borrowed from activewear.
  • Bold Colors and Prints: Women in healthcare are embracing scrubs in bold colors and vibrant prints, moving away from traditional solid colors to express their individuality and personality.

3. Fabric Innovations:

  • Antimicrobial Fabrics: With hygiene being a top priority in healthcare settings, antimicrobial fabrics are becoming standard in scrubs, helping to minimize the spread of bacteria and ensuring a clean and safe environment.
  • Moisture-Wicking Technology: Fabrics with moisture-wicking properties are essential for keeping healthcare professionals dry and comfortable during long shifts, preventing sweat buildup and enhancing overall comfort.
  • Sustainable Materials: As sustainability becomes more important across industries, healthcare apparel brands are incorporating eco-friendly materials like organic cotton and recycled polyester into their scrub designs, offering options that are both stylish and environmentally responsible.

5. Practical Tips for Choosing Scrubs:

  • Fit Matters: Ensure the scrubs fit well and allow for ease of movement, especially during demanding shifts.
  • Consider Functionality: Look for scrubs with ample pockets, loops for accessories, and other functional details that enhance efficiency and convenience.
  • Personal Style: Don’t be afraid to choose scrubs that reflect your personality while still adhering to workplace dress codes and professional standards.
